AJAX和JSONP是前端开发中常用的异步请求和跨域解决方案。本文将详细介绍它们的使用方法和源代码示例。
一、AJAX(Asynchronous JavaScript and XML)
AJAX是一种在不刷新整个页面的情况下,通过JavaScript与服务器进行异步通信的技术。它可以实现页面的局部刷新,提升用户体验。
- 发起AJAX请求
以下是一个简单的AJAX请求的示例:
var xhr = new XMLHttpRequest();
xhr.open('GET',
本文详细介绍了AJAX和JSONP在前端开发中的应用,包括如何发起AJAX GET和POST请求,以及JSONP的原理和实现跨域请求的示例。AJAX用于异步通信,实现页面局部刷新,而JSONP则是解决跨域问题的一种策略,利用动态插入script标签来获取数据。
AJAX和JSONP是前端开发中常用的异步请求和跨域解决方案。本文将详细介绍它们的使用方法和源代码示例。
一、AJAX(Asynchronous JavaScript and XML)
AJAX是一种在不刷新整个页面的情况下,通过JavaScript与服务器进行异步通信的技术。它可以实现页面的局部刷新,提升用户体验。
var xhr = new XMLHttpRequest();
xhr.open('GET',
4196

被折叠的 条评论
为什么被折叠?